How to Separate a One-Off Food Reaction From a Repeating Pattern

You ate something, and hours later you were in the bathroom, cramping and miserable. The obvious conclusion is that the food did it. That conclusion is often wrong, and acting on it quickly is how people with inflammatory bowel disease (IBD) end up with a shrinking list of safe foods and no better symptom control. Deciding whether you have a one-off food reaction or a trigger requires evidence about repeatability rather than one memorable night.

Self-reported food intolerance is close to universal in IBD. In one comparison, 88% of Crohn's disease patients and 90% of ulcerative colitis patients reported at least one food intolerance, versus 30% of healthy controls, averaging three intolerances each. Those numbers run far ahead of what blinded testing supports. Perceived intolerances routinely overestimate the prevalence of a true reaction to food, and when people who believe they react to gluten are tested under blinded conditions, fructans rather than gluten usually explain the symptoms.

Why a single bad episode is weak evidence

IBD symptoms fluctuate on their own. The National Institute of Diabetes and Digestive and Kidney Diseases describes ulcerative colitis as a disease with periods of remission lasting weeks or years followed by relapse, and severity that varies from a few loose stools to more than ten bloody movements a day. Underneath that, symptoms and inflammation do not track each other reliably. In many patients, abdominal pain, bloating and diarrhea are out of proportion to the demonstrated degree of inflammation, and some symptomatic patients have complete mucosal healing, with a majority of people in stable remission meeting criteria for irritable bowel syndrome.

Against that background, one bad day after one meal carries little information. Bad days land next to meals by chance alone, because you eat several times a day and symptoms arrive whether or not you ate anything unusual. The evidence comes from whether the same food produces the same result when the rest of your life is different.

Confounders that imitate a food trigger

Most false trigger foods were eaten during a week when something else was going wrong. Psychological distress is the best documented of these. In a longitudinal study, baseline distress predicted higher self-reported disease activity six months later, with impaired sleep quality accounting for 55.5% of that effect, and distress did not predict fecal calprotectin, meaning it moved how patients felt more than how inflamed they were. A review of modifiable flare factors found that high perceived stress carried 3.6 times higher odds of clinical flare in ulcerative colitis and sleep disturbance roughly tripled relapse risk, and a separate analysis put sleep disturbance at 1.6 to 2-fold higher flare risk in Crohn's disease. Belief also colors reporting: among IBD patients who thought stress triggered their flares, depressive symptoms correlated with disease activity, while no such correlation appeared in patients who did not hold that belief.

Hormonal cycling is a second imitator. A prospective study of 47 women with IBD found more severe abdominal pain and worse general condition during the menstrual phase, alongside more frequent premenstrual gastrointestinal symptoms than controls, while nocturnal diarrhea and bloody stools did not change across the cycle. A broader review reports worsening gastrointestinal symptoms during premenstrual and menstrual phases in both IBS and IBD, with prolonged transit during the luteal phase. Medication changes belong on the same list, since NSAID use and certain antibiotics, including quinolones and beta-lactams, were both linked to higher relapse risk. So does an ordinary gastrointestinal infection, which arrives on its own schedule and overlaps with whatever you happened to eat.

How many exposures before you call it a pattern

There is no validated number for food challenges in IBD, but single-patient experimental design gives a useful reference point. In a review of 74 randomized n-of-1 trials, which exist to establish cause and effect within one individual, the median number of crossover periods was six, and more than half measured the outcome multiple times within each period. The reason for repetition is explicit: a greater number of periods reduces the confounding effects of other lifestyle changes, and carryover from a previous exposure can distort the next one unless enough time separates them.

Translated into food, three separated exposures is a reasonable working minimum, and more is better when the food is nutritionally valuable. Two reactions out of two is suggestive. Two out of six is close to what chance would produce. A pattern also needs consistency beyond the yes-or-no answer. If the reaction appears sometimes at four hours and sometimes at two days, or follows a small portion but not a large one, dose and timing point away from that food.

A pattern-review worksheet

Before you cut a food, write down what you actually have. For each exposure, record the date, portion size, preparation method, hours until symptoms began, and the symptoms themselves. Then, in separate columns on those same dates, record the confounders.

  • Sleep the night before, and stress or a major life event in the preceding week
  • Cycle day for menstruating patients, and any new or missed medication, antibiotic, or NSAID
  • Any illness, travel, or known infection in the household

Now count. How many exposures do you have, how many produced symptoms, and of those, how many also carried a confounder? A food that reacts three times out of four, with clean confounder columns and a consistent lag, is worth acting on. A food with two reactions that both landed in a bad-sleep, high-stress week has not been tested yet. The worksheet also guards against the opposite error, where a real trigger gets dismissed because the one uneventful exposure was a tiny portion.

What a wrong conclusion costs

Restriction carries a price. In a cross-sectional IBD study, malnourished patients were far more likely to maintain dietary restrictions outside of flares than well-nourished patients, 62.5% versus 17.5%, and malnutrition tracked with corticosteroid use and severe disease activity. Foods removed on thin evidence tend to stay removed, because people rarely retest. NIDDK notes that researchers have not found specific foods that cause or worsen Crohn's disease, and suggests a food diary to identify foods that seem to make symptoms worse in consultation with a clinician rather than blanket elimination.

A food earns the label of trigger when it produces the same reaction across several separated exposures, at a consistent dose and lag, on days when nothing else obvious was happening. A single bad night earns a note in the log and a plan to test it again later. Symptoms that persist regardless of what you eat, or that come with blood, fever, or weight loss, are a reason to contact your gastroenterology team rather than to keep editing your grocery list.
